Wyckoff is a city in New Jersey, located in Bergen County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 16,866 residents. It is a mature city, with a median age of 47.4 years.
Economically, Wyckoff is a affluent community. The median household income of $196,632 is more than double the national average. Approximately 2.3%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 4.9%, near the national average.
The real estate market in Wyckoff is among the most expensive housing markets in the country. Median home values stand at $908,900, which is more than double the national average. Renters typically pay around $2,092 per month. Homeownership is high at 90.9%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.
The population of Wyckoff is highly educated. 74.3%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— significantly above the national average. The community is primarily White (85.49%).
